voidsolve(){ int n; cin >> n; int ans = 0, t = 0; for(int i = 1; i <= n; i++) { int a, b; cin >> a >> b; if(a <= 10 && b > ans) { ans = b; t = i; } } cout << t << endl; }
intmain(){ int t; cin >> t; while(t--) solve(); return0; }
voidsolve(){ int n, k; cin >> n >> k; vector<int> a(n); for(int i = 0; i < n; i++) cin >> a[i]; int ans = 1, b = 1; sort(a.begin(), a.end()); for(int i = 1; i < n; i++) { if(a[i] - a[i - 1] <= k) { b++; ans = max(ans, b); }else{ b = 1; } } cout << n - ans << endl; }
intmain(){ int t; cin >> t; while(t--) solve(); return0; }
voidsolve(){ longdouble n, c, b = 0; cin >> n >> c; vector<longdouble> a(n); for(int i = 0; i < n; i++) { cin >> a[i]; c -= a[i] * a[i]; b += a[i]; } b *= 4; longdouble ta = 4 * n; // cout << ta << ' ' << b << ' ' << c << endl; longdouble ans = (sqrt(b * b + 4 * ta * c) - b) / (2 * ta); cout << (ll)ans << endl; }
intmain(){ int t; cin >> t; while(t--) solve(); return0; }